Headlight upgrade?

Featured Replies

Hi all, havnt been on here for a while now. Now a proud owner of a mk1 VRS. Have had the car about 6 months. Anyways i am after fitting some upgrade headlights such as aftermarket units which allow use of hid's. I find the stock halogen lights very poor, i have fitted uprated phillips bulbs but there still not very good. Can't find any oem projector units which were fitted to some of the mk1 models. Can anyone please give me some help on this issue?

Thanks

ISTR that L&K 130s had Xenon dip plus halogen mains as standard.

As Ken said either look out for a PD130 L&K or a 1.8T L&K (or even a VRS WRC edition) all these came with Xenons as standard and the Elegances and VRS's had Xenons as an option. Either look in the local breakers yards or keep an eye out on ebay. There are part numbers floating round somewhere on this forum if you want to buy the light units and all the bits you need from Skoda but if I remember rightly they were something like £500-600 new from the dealers

To stay legal though, you'd need to retrofit the sensors on the suspension and headlight washers too in addition to the projector lens xenon headlight units. Not cheap!

The other issue with using Octy xenon headlamp units is I don't know if the levelling would be plug and play with a manual levelling wheel in the cabin? The levelling motors on the xenons seem to be much faster reacting so I'd guess that they are a different system . . . I might be wrong though.:)

Best person to ask is NinjaVRS, I think his set-up is genuine Skoda HID units, but without the autolevelling, they are wired into the manual levelling controller which makes them legal (they have to be adjustable whether manually or automatically)
